To ensure compliance, we have established communication channels through which employees and third parties can report suspected illegal or unethical conduct.

If you have noticed behavior that violates the law, internal regulations, or the Code of Ethics (e.g., corruption, fraud, or human rights violations), you can report it using the secure form below.

You can submit your report anonymously or under your own name. In both cases, we guarantee confidentiality and protection of your identity. If you wish to remain anonymous, enter "anonymous" in the name field, use an anonymous email address, and make sure that any attached files do not contain your personal data.

In order for your report to be properly assessed and investigated, please ensure that it contains as much specific information as possible. When submitting a report, please try to answer the following questions:

What is your relationship to ELBA, a.s.?

Who does the report concern? Who was involved?

What happened? Describe the incident itself, the violation, your concern.

When and where did the unfair practice, (illegal) advantage, or misconduct occur?

How often did the situation occur? How long did it last?

Do you have specific evidence to support your claims? Emails, records, documents? Are there other witnesses to the event?
